N-Myc downstream regulated gene 1b is a regulator of cell adhesion during early muscle development

<h4>ABSTRACT</h4> The complexity of cellular functions necessitates intricate pathways that govern protein synthesis, transport, and degradation; yet the mechanisms governing the trafficking of key developmental proteins in vivo remain incompletely understood.
